流程...

最近在Jakarta和MicroProfile社区中有很多关于流程的讨论,因此我只想提醒我们有关敏捷宣言的所有内容。

在流程和工具上的个人和互动

https://agilemanifesto.org/

也就是说,需要一些过程。 尤其适用于规范。 在本文中,我将解释Jakarta EE规范流程,并大声思考如何将相同的原理应用于Eclipse MicroProfile。

雅加达EE规范流程( JESP )源自基础规范流程( EFSP )。 简短的版本是指定各种评论的投票期(投票)多长时间:

  • 创作评论:7天
  • 计划审查:7天
  • 进度审查:14天
  • 发布审核:14天
  • 服务发布审核:14天

下图显示了整个过程。

那么,使用JESP制定规范的速度有多快?
好了,您将需要提出一个规范项目建议并将其提交以供审查。 这份审查最多可能需要7天才能完成。

下一步是为Jakarta EE规范委员会的计划审查提出发布计划。 此步骤是可选的,是项目确保您走上正确道路的一种手段。 假设我们选择加入此评论,这意味着还要再进行7天,即到目前为止总共14天。

准备发布规范时,您将其提交以供发布审核。 这将需要14天才能完成,并且可能与Jakarta EE规范委员会的批准同时进行。 这样一来,根据您的规范进行审核的总天数将为28天

没有计划的审查,我们需要21天的时间 ,这与Eclipse Development Process( EDP )之后的任何项目都完全相同。 这适用于例如Eclipse MicroProfile项目 。

Jakarta EE和Eclipse MicroProfile的治理模型之间的区别在于,Jakarta EE是一个工作组,并且具有规范流程,可以在发布规范之前捕获知识产权。 Eclipse MicroProfile是带有临时规范过程的标准Eclipse Foundation项目。 作为Eclipse Foundation项目,项目名称必须以Eclipse为前缀。 作为工作组,此限制不适用。

在下表中,我总结了一些相似之处和不同之处,甚至还可以自由地拟定建立具有自己规范流程的MicroProfile工作组的外观。

雅加达EE Eclipse MicroProfile
(作为一个项目)
MicroProfile
(作为工作组)
规范流程 JESP 没有 MSP(*)
开发过程 电子数据处理 电子数据处理 电子数据处理
发布审查 14天 14天 14天
批准书 没有
工作小组 没有
项目名称 雅加达[规格] Eclipse MicroProfile [规格] MicroProfile [规格]
Jakarta EE消耗的规格 没有
Eclipse MicroProfile消耗的规格

(*)大声思考:MicroProfile规范流程(MSP)

MicroProfile规范过程可以这样简单:采用具有以下投票期限(选票)的EFSP:
(……还在大声思考……)

  • 创作审查:7天(根据EDP的规定为今天)
  • 计划审查:7天 (或今天可选)
  • 进度审查:7天
  • 发布审核:14天
  • 服务发布审核:14天

综上所述,我认为JESP尽可能轻量级地保留了“ 每个人与流程和工具之间的互动 ”的本质,同时仍然保护了每个参与者。

翻译自: https://www.javacodegeeks.com/2019/11/processes.html


本文来自互联网用户投稿,文章观点仅代表作者本人,不代表本站立场,不承担相关法律责任。如若转载,请注明出处。 如若内容造成侵权/违法违规/事实不符,请点击【内容举报】进行投诉反馈!

相关文章

立即
投稿

微信公众账号

微信扫一扫加关注

返回
顶部